Eco-Friendly Cleaning for Surface Preparation and Restoration

TLM Laser’s cleaning systems offer a non-abrasive solution for removing contaminants, coatings, or residues from wood surfaces. This process is ideal for restoring aged surfaces to their original state.

Working with 4JET, we provide cleaning solutions that preserve the natural texture of wood while improving its durability and appearance. This eco-friendly approach ensures minimal waste and maximum efficiency for industrial and artisan woodworking applications.

Precision Cutting for Decorative and Functional Woodworking

TLM Laser’s cutting systems enable intricate and clean cuts on wood materials, making them perfect for furniture production, decorative elements, and industrial applications. These systems ensure accuracy, speed, and reduced material waste, supporting efficiency across various scales of production.
